Wayne_Cowdrey said:Does anyone think stones has become too much of a speed event now? Or is that a debate for another day/thread?

Well done to the Brits. Some good stuff from you guys Happy


Yes, it used to be only a few guys could lift the fifth stone, other than obviously Burke bulldozing the platform and Loz who I can only guess is carrying an injury everyone in the final did all 5. Either add an extra stone, make them heavier or go back to not being able to use tacky. The last stone should be an achievement that few in the world are capable of it is the final of Worlds strongest man after all!
